
P63.XZ is XZ-axis moving piezoelectric nano-positioning stage. It adopts the design principle of piezoelectric stack direct-drive mechanism and could achieve nano-level resolution and positioning accuracy, has very high reliability, and plays an important role in the field of precision positioning.

Small Size Quick Response
P63 piezoelectric nano positioning stage is characterized by high precision and small size. The size of the P63.X is only 30×30×21mm (XYZ axis is 30×30×42mm), which is very easy to integrate into the scanning instrument. |

Note:When installed vertically, the load capacity depends on the specific installation direction.
| Mounting Method |
Horizontal Mounting |
Vertical Mounting |
Inverted Mounting |
| Definition |
Place the PZT platform horizontally for installation, with the moving surface located above the PZT platform and parallel to the horizontal plane.
PS: Default direction for carrying capacity in the parameter table
|
Place and install the PZT platform vertically, with the moving surface parallel to the direction of gravity
|
Place the PZT platform horizontally, but the moving surface is located below the PZT platform |
